Catalogued under GNIS Feature ID 581173, Pine Hill is recorded as a summit on the USGS Center Lovell quadrangle in Oxford County, Maine (FIPS 23/017). Last revised by the Board on Geographic Names on 11/30/2018.

Coordinates & physical setting

Pine Hill sits at 44.24378° N, 70.88964° W (DMS 44°14′38″ N, 70°53′23″ W).
